Core Tip |
Transgender persons may account for approximately up to 0.3% of the population. Their access to health care and medications may be hampered in the coronavirus disease 19 (COVID-19) era. The effects of COVID-19 per se on the liver may not be negligible. In this concise review we ponder on these effects, honed on transgender persons. |
